In the realm of digital communication, chatbots have become ubiquitous tools for engaging with users and streamlining interactions. However, recent revelations have uncovered a series of security vulnerabilities within ChatGPT, a popular chatbot framework, that have left users’ data perilously exposed to potential exploitation. These multiple security bugs have opened the floodgates for attackers to not only access sensitive information but also inject malicious prompts, bypass safety measures, and carry out a plethora of nefarious activities.
One of the most alarming implications of these vulnerabilities is the ability for attackers to inject arbitrary prompts into the chatbot conversations. Imagine a scenario where a seemingly innocuous chat takes a sinister turn as a malicious prompt is slipped into the dialogue, coercing users into divulging confidential information or unknowingly granting access to sensitive data. This insidious tactic can deceive even the most vigilant users, highlighting the critical need for robust security measures within chatbot frameworks.
Moreover, the potential for attackers to exfiltrate personal user information poses a grave threat to individuals and organizations alike. With the ability to siphon off data ranging from email addresses and contact details to financial information, the repercussions of such breaches are far-reaching and devastating. The aftermath of data theft can lead to identity fraud, financial loss, and irreparable damage to both reputation and trust.
The discovery of these security vulnerabilities also raises concerns about the efficacy of safety mechanisms within chatbot frameworks. Attackers exploiting these bugs can circumvent existing safeguards, rendering them ineffective in the face of sophisticated cyber threats. This loophole not only undermines the integrity of the chatbot platform but also erodes user confidence in the security measures put in place to protect their data.
